I’m trying to figure out how I feel about the end. I like the overall message of the involvement of Candace and I also think that how the end was written made me really feel her kind of descending into a kind of madness… the paranoia and irrational thinking etc were really well done in my opinion. However I feel like the instagram account and the dressing in Athena’s clothes etc felt maybe a little like… scooby doo?? Idk, maybe something a bit more simple and less grand plot would’ve been a more satisfying conclusion - although I’m not sure how that would’ve been done and I think I understand and least partially why it was done how it was done. That being said, loved this book. Read it in one sitting. It was engaging and I felt really immersed in the world. The characters were all brilliantly flawed and frustrating and the whole thing felt very real (and taught me/made me realise a lot about the publishing industry!)
